A Professional Certificate in Biophysics for Cell Biologists provides advanced training in the application of physical principles to biological systems at the cellular level. This specialized program equips participants with the quantitative skills necessary to analyze complex biological processes.
Learning outcomes typically include a deep understanding of membrane biophysics, molecular motors, protein dynamics, and advanced microscopy techniques. Students will develop proficiency in data analysis and modeling, crucial for interpreting experimental results and designing new experiments in cell biology research. The program also fosters critical thinking and problem-solving abilities within the context of biophysical research questions.
The duration of a Professional Certificate in Biophysics for Cell Biologists can vary depending on the institution, but generally ranges from a few months to a year of intensive study. The curriculum often involves a combination of lectures, laboratory work, and independent projects designed to provide hands-on experience with relevant technologies.
